This morning, in the conference room of the Shanghai Jiading Public Security Bureau, 59-year-old Wang Jinhu met 80-year-old Qin Zhenying. After nearly 60 years of separation, he can finally shout "Mom" to his biological mother.

Wang Jinhu was one of tens of thousands of abandoned babies sent to the north during the "three years of natural disasters". In the first half of his life, he reconciled with himself, and in the second half of his life, he worked hard to find relatives, and in the past 13 years, Wang Jinhu has gone south to Shanghai no less than ten times, but each time he has returned disappointed.

The regrets left by the difficult years, today, finally have a happy ending.

Scars on the ears

There were two wounds on Wang Jinhu's ear pinna, which remained faintly white after many years of healing. It was cut with scissors.

When he was 6 years old, Wang Jinhu, who lived in Luoyang, learned the biggest secret of his life: he was an adopted son. At that time, his mother took him out, and someone asked, "Is this the Shanghai baby you raised?" Mom replied, "Yeah. Wang Jinhu seemed ignorant on the side, but he listened to everything in his heart.

He felt uncomfortable and wanted to find the answer to all this, but because he was too young, there was nothing he could do. Since then, the grief of being abandoned by loved ones has remained with me. It wasn't until he was 13 that he finally learned the meaning of those two scars on his ears.

He saw in the book that the scars on the ears or the scars on the body were originally marks made by farmers in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Shanghai on their livestock. During the "three years of natural disasters", there was a great famine in Jiangnan, and many children were tearfully abandoned by their parents. After the welfare home adopted these children, they were sent to the north in batches to find a solid family for adoption. These children are also known as the "children of the nation."

At that time, when some parents made helpless choices, they also held up a glimmer of hope and left a mark as a marker for future relatives.

From growing up to getting married and having children, Wang Jinhu has always kept his secrets, and even his wife has not revealed it. It wasn't until one summer night in 1990 that he dreamed of his relatives in Shanghai, who, though their faces were vague, were calling his name.

The next day, he bought a train ticket to Shanghai. At that time, he had no clue, just guessed that the conditions at home were not good, heard that the development of Zhabei District was backward, he guarded Zhabei, and went around in circles on the Suzhou River every day, staring at one window after another, trying to find a face similar to his own. It's often a night of staring.

It is conceivable that all this will not bear fruit. The idea of looking for relatives was gradually hidden in the depths of memory. But the two scars on his ears that had been cut for recognition made Wang Jinhu unable to die.

In early April 2009, Wang Jinhu, who was already 46 years old, somehow talked about his own life in a small talk with his elders. Unexpectedly, it was this small talk that actually let him know his name before he was raised: "Mao Fan", and even learned that he was from Jiading, Shanghai.

The suppressed search for relatives in my heart burst forth again. During the May Day Golden Week that year, Wang Jinhu, who had about 18 fellow villagers who had similar experiences with him, once again embarked on a journey to Shanghai to find relatives.

At the Jiacheng police station of the Jiading branch, Wang Jinhu checked the household registration file and found "Mao Fan". The date on which the household registration was moved coincided with the time he knew to have moved to Luoyang, Henan. Among the companions, some people also found the original file that matched their household registration. At that time, a sense of joy that was getting closer and closer to the truth spread in the small search procession.

After several rushes and contacts, the family search group held a "family recognition rally" at the Jiading Fucheng Experimental Primary School with the help of the police station. But there are not many families who come to look for their separated relatives, only two families have identified photos of their childhood, and some vague memories, and vaguely feel that two people may be children who were adopted at that time.

But in the end, the DNA comparison was unsuccessful, so the family search team returned to Luoyang with regrets. The crowd did not give up, and Wang Jinhu continued to cheer up his companions. The following year, during the "May Day" Golden Week, they gathered again and came to this former hometown. Then the third year, the fourth year... This family search trip lasted for 13 years, and the number of people slowly expanded from the initial 18 to more than 300 people. Wang Jinhu, the initiator of that year, also became the leader of the search for relatives.

Late reunion

From 2009 to 2021, in the spring and autumn of 12 years, Wang Jinhu has helped more than 10 long-lost families to reunite.

Looking at one child after another who has left home thousands of miles and returned to the arms of his parents, Wang Jinhu is not only happy, but also has a trace of inexplicable and inexplicable loss. After all, when he first set foot on the strange homeland of Jiading, he already knew his childhood name and knew that his roots were here. But after 12 years of running, it is always difficult to find relatives, what a pity.

Just when Wang Jinhu thought that he would spend the year again in loss and waiting, a phone call from the Jiading Public Security Bureau made his calm heart wave again.

On the evening of December 23, Wang Jinhu was having dinner with his wife when Wang Xiang, a police officer from the Jiading Public Security Bureau who had been in contact with him, suddenly called. From picking up the mobile phone to the "beep" sound after hanging up in the earpiece, Wang Jinhu has been stupidly maintaining the answering action, but in his mind is an uproar, and The sentence of Officer Wang has always been echoing: "Tell you a good news, we may have found your relatives, and this time the possibility is very large!" ”

Unspeakable anticipation and anxiety began to fill the phone from the moment I put down my phone. In those days, Wang Jinhu's heart has always been unable to calm down, and has been churning and fluctuating in various emotions.

On December 26, Wang Jinhu's WeChat suddenly received a friend application, and the other Party's WeChat name was "Juanzi". At first, he thought it was someone who came to the search group for help, but he did not expect that just after passing the application, the other party called the video phone. After the connection, the people at both ends of the screen looked at each other and were speechless for a long time.

When the silence was broken, the other party asked a question that Wang Jinhu had been waiting for for many years: "Are you my brother?" The wife next to her noticed something strange, leaned over to look at it, and was stunned when she saw it. Because with just one glance, she was sure that the woman in the picture must be the relatives that her husband had been looking for for many years, and that eyebrow and look were exactly the same as Wang Jinhu's daughter!

Yes, this "Juanzi" is Wang Jinhu's sister.

It turned out that in June this year, with the assistance of the Jiading police, Wang Jinhu's biological samples were successively sent to large and small cities in Jiangsu, Zhejiang, and Shanghai for comparison. On December 23, an old uncle in Kunshan, Jiangsu Province, was selected, but after further investigation, the old uncle was not Wang Jinhu's immediate family, but his paternal relatives, who should be cousins according to generations.

Crucially, the cousin provided an important clue: the cousin's family, who had sent away the child, had been living in the Jiading Huating area for a long time. According to this clue, the community police of the Jiading Huating police station quickly found the family of Mrs. Qin, who may be Wang Jinhu's family - when Wang Jinhu was young, the photo was taken to the local elderly to identify, and several people recognized it at a glance, which was the "Mao Fan" who was sent away that year.

The next day, the police of the Criminal Division of the Jiading Public Security Bureau drove to Mrs. Qin's house, collected biological sample information for the whole family, and began to analyze and compare without stopping. On December 29, preliminary results confirmed that Wang Jinhu was related to Mrs. Qin. On December 30th, the second re-examination, just like the same!

A period of family affection that has been submerged in the vast sea of people for nearly a year has finally continued at the beginning of the New Year.
